Legacy Sigma-Delta Modulator Driver is Removed
|
||||
----------------------------------------------
|
||||
|
||||
The legacy Sigma-Delta Modulator driver ``driver/sigmadelta.h`` is deprecated since version 5.0 (see :ref:`deprecate_sdm_legacy_driver`). Starting from version 6.0, the legacy driver is completely removed. The new driver is placed in the :component:`esp_driver_sdm`, and the header file path is ``driver/sdm.h``.
